Harold William Rosenberg (born 19 February 1941 in New York City) is an American mathematician who works on differential geometry.[1]

Rosenberg has worked at Columbia University, at the Institut des Hautes Études Scientifiques, and at the University of Paris. He currently works at the IMPA, Brazil.[1]

He earned his Ph.D. at the University of California, Berkeley in 1963 under the supervision of Stephen P. L. Diliberto.[2]

He is a member of the Brazilian Academy of Sciences since 2004.[1]

His students include Norbert A'Campo, Christian Bonatti and Michael Herman.[2]

In 2005, together with William H. Meeks, he proved Osserman's conjecture on minimal surfaces.[3]
